summ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orBenjamin Kramer <benny.kra@googlemail.com>2014-07-23 11:49:49 +0000
committerBenjamin Kramer <benny.kra@googlemail.com>2014-07-23 11:49:49 +0000
commitd025f90c99baf3df52d671b2a63db79ed2cb478d (patch)
tree10c2b24d9ba7f0e396e64139cefd7b80c29d4e4d
parentda3658e2b7f59c8a32f815f3309b61ef1a86c86b (diff)
downloadbcm5719-llvm-d025f90c99baf3df52d671b2a63db79ed2cb478d.tar.gz
bcm5719-llvm-d025f90c99baf3df52d671b2a63db79ed2cb478d.zip
check_clang_tidy_fix.sh: Fail immediately if clang-tidy crashes.
Otherwise we'll get confusing messages from FileCheck instead of seeing the real issue. llvm-svn: 213739
-rwxr-xr-xclang-tools-extra/test/clang-tidy/check_clang_tidy_fix.sh2
1 files changed, 1 insertions, 1 deletions
diff --git a/clang-tools-extra/test/clang-tidy/check_clang_tidy_fix.sh b/clang-tools-extra/test/clang-tidy/check_clang_tidy_fix.sh
index 1fc9dcc4b78..b6c0703103a 100755
--- a/clang-tools-extra/test/clang-tidy/check_clang_tidy_fix.sh
+++ b/clang-tools-extra/test/clang-tidy/check_clang_tidy_fix.sh
@@ -12,7 +12,7 @@ TEMPORARY_FILE=$3.cpp
sed 's#// *[A-Z-]\+:.*#//#' ${INPUT_FILE} > ${TEMPORARY_FILE}
clang-tidy ${TEMPORARY_FILE} -fix --checks="-*,${CHECK_TO_RUN}" -- --std=c++11 \
- > ${TEMPORARY_FILE}.msg 2>&1
+ > ${TEMPORARY_FILE}.msg 2>&1 || exit $?
FileCheck -input-file=${TEMPORARY_FILE} ${INPUT_FILE} \
-check-prefix=CHECK-FIXES -strict-whitespace || exit $?
OpenPOWER on IntegriCloud